The Cybersecurity in Critical Infrastructure Market was valued at USD 21.60 billion in 2023 and is expected to reach USD 30.96 Bill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 4.10 % over the forecast period 2024-2032.
Cybersecurity in Critical Infrastructure Market is gaining urgent attention as global threats escalate and the digital backbone of economies becomes more complex. With utilities, transportation, defense, energy, and healthcare sectors facing increased exposure to cyber risks, governments and enterprises across the U.S. and Europe are accelerating investments in resilient cybersecurity frameworks. Recent incidents have underscored the vulnerability of critical assets, prompting regulatory bodies to enforce stricter security mandates and risk assessments.
Cybersecurity in Critical Infrastructure Market is being redefined by the convergence of OT (Operational Technology) and IT, with organizations now requiring unified defense mechanisms. This evolution is driving demand for advanced threat detection, incident response automation, and end-to-end encryption solutions. The market is also witnessing a surge in zero-trust architecture and AI-powered threat intelligence to defend against increasingly sophisticated cyber-attacks targeting essential services.

Market Analysis
The rapid adoption of digital control systems, smart grids, and IoT-enabled infrastructure has expanded the cyber-attack surface of critical sectors. Both government and private stakeholders are acknowledging that the disruption of infrastructure—such as power plants, water supplies, or public transit systems—can result in national-level consequences. The U.S. is pushing initiatives under the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A), while the EU enforces NIS2 directives to bolster member state defenses.
